This procurement seeks to establish two, not for profit, Community Supermarkets, one (1) in Canvey Island, Castle Point (Lot 1) and one (1) in Greenstead, Colchester (Lot 2). \r \r Priority areas for this procurement are based on the Essex County Council, Levelling-Up geographies, and Working Families priority areas, overlayed with the 2019 Indices of Multiple Deprivation (IMD). \r \r It is important that any Community Supermarket is established with the support of local, public, voluntary and community sector partners as well as local-residents and service users.\r \r The Community Supermarket model provides support for individuals who have experienced financial crisis, and who have been supported by Food Banks to regain some financial control. In addition, the model supports individuals and families who fluctuate above and below the line of financial security by providing a consistent point of support to avoid them falling into financial crisis. \r \r Once established, the programmes will form a local community asset with the funding from Essex County Council made available to seed fund the development and start up costs.\r Additional information: The requirement is divided into two geographical areas and are described as Lots. These are as follows. Lot 1 - Canvey Island - total grant available £68,236, duration 12 months Lot 2 - Greenstead, Colchester - total grant available £147,659 over 2 years
